MarkDown基础

一、MarkDown标题

1.使用=和-表示一级标题
2.使用#、##、###、####、######、######表示一级至六级标题

一级标题

二级标题

一级标题

二级标题

三级标题

四级标题
五级标题
六级标题

二、MarkDown标题

1.Markdown 段落没有特殊的格式,直接编写文字就好,段落的换行是使用两个以上空格加上回车
2.也可以在段落后面使用一个空行来表示重新开始一个段落

使用两个以上空格+回车换行
换行
不使用空格直接回车第二行会显示在同一行
使用一个空格回车 第二行还是显示在同一行
在段落后使用一个空行来表示新的段落
新的段落

2.1 字体

1.使用*来控制字体
2.使用下划线_来控制字体

斜体文本
斜体文本
粗体文本
粗体文本
粗斜体文本
粗斜体文本

2.2 分隔线

1.你可以在一行中用三个以上的星号、减号、底线来建立一个分隔线,行内不能有其他东西
2.也可以在星号或是减号中间插入空格

星号分隔


减号分隔








2.3 分删除线

只需要在需要删除的内容前后加上两个~线即可

这是一句话
这是要删除的话

2.4 下划线

下划线可以通过 HTML 的 <u> 标签来实现

这是下划线标签

2.5 脚注

脚注是对文本的补充说明,可以使用[^脚注]来表示脚注

创建一个脚注 1

三、MarkDown列表

1.无序列表使用星号(*)、加号(+)或是减号(-)作为列表标记,这些标记后面要添加一个空格
2.有序列表使用数字并加上 . 号来表示

  • 星号无序列表
  • 加号无序列表
  • 减号无序列表
  1. 有序列表
  2. 有序列表

3.1 列表嵌套

  1. 第一项
    • 无序列表
  • 第一层
    • 第二层
      • 第三层
        • 第四层
          • 第五层
            • 第六层

四、MarkDown区块

Markdown区块引用是在段落开头使用 > 符号,并且后面紧跟一个空格

使用区块

区块嵌套第一层

区块嵌套第二层

第三层

区块中使用列表

  1. 第一项
  2. 第二项
  • 第一项
  • 第二项
  • 第三项
  1. 列表中使用区块

区块1
区块2

  1. 第二项

五、MarkDown代码

如果是段落上的一个函数或片段的代码可以用反引号把它包起来(`)
可以使用```包括代码段,也可以使用四个空格或制表符显示代码段落

显示 print() 函数

<?php echo 'out'; function test(){ echo 'test'; } ```javascript $(document).ready(function () { alert('HelloWorld'); }); ```

六、MarkDown链接

这是一个链接 百度百科

或者直接使用链接地址 https://www.baidu.com

这个链接用 1 作为网址变量 Google
这个链接用 baidu 作为网址变量 baidu
然后在文档的结尾为变量赋值(网址)

七、MarkDown图片

在这里插入图片描述

<img decoding="async" src="https://static.zhihu.com/heifetz/assets/apple-touch-icon-152.81060cab.png" width="20%">

八、MarkDown表格

Markdown 制作表格使用 | 来分隔不同的单元格,使用 - 来分隔表头和其他行。

没有表头和其他行的分隔线
| 表头 | 表头 |
| 单元格 | 单元格 |
| 单元格 | 单元格 |

有分隔线

表头表头
单元格单元格
单元格单元格

8.1 对齐方式

我们可以设置表格的对齐方式:
-: 设置内容和标题栏居右对齐
:- 设置内容和标题栏居左对齐
:-: 设置内容和标题栏居中对齐

左对齐居中右对齐
单元格单元格单元格
单元格单元格单元格

九、MarkDown高级技巧

9.1 支持的 HTML 元素

不在 Markdown 涵盖范围之内的标签,都可以直接在文档里面用 HTML 撰写
目前支持的 HTML 元素有:<kbd> <b> <i> <em> <sup> <sub> <br>等

使用 Ctrl+Alt+Del 重启电脑

9.2 转义

Markdown 使用了很多特殊符号来表示特定的意义,如果需要显示特定的符号则需要使用转义字符,Markdown 使用反斜杠转义特殊字符

** 正常显示星号 **

Markdown 支持以下这些符号前面加上反斜杠来帮助插入普通的符号:
\ 反斜线
` 反引号
* 星号
_ 下划线
{} 花括号
[] 方括号
() 小括号
# 井字号
+ 加号
- 减号
. 英文句点
! 感叹号

十、数学公式

Markdown Preview Enhanced 使用 LaTeX 或者 MathJax 来渲染数学表达式
$…$ 或者 (…) 中的数学表达式将会在行内显示
$$…$$ 或者 […] 或者 ```math 中的数学表达式将会在块内显示。

$f(x)=sin(x)$

f ( x ) = s i n ( x ) f(x)=sin(x) f(x)=sin(x)

$a^2$

a 2 a^2 a2

$$\sum_{n=1}^{100} n$$

∑ n = 1 100 n \sum_{n=1}^{100} n n=1100n

$$
\begin{Bmatrix}
   a & b \\
   c & d
\end{Bmatrix}
$$

{ a b c d } \begin{Bmatrix} a & b \\ c & d \end{Bmatrix} {acbd}

$$\boxed{\sum\limits_{i = 1}^{n} i = \dfrac{n(n - 1)}{2}}$$

∑ i = 1 n i = n ( n − 1 ) 2 \boxed{\sum\limits_{i = 1}^{n} i = \dfrac{n(n - 1)}{2}} i=1ni=2n(n1)

$\sum_{i=1}^na_i$   

$\sum\limits_{i=1}^na_i$  

$\prod_{i=1}^na_i$  

$\prod\limits_{i=1}^na_i$  

$\lim_{n\to\infty}x_n$  

$\lim\limits_{n\to\infty}x_n$

$\int_{-N}^{N}e^x dx$  

$\iint_M^Ndx dy$

$\iiint_M^Ndx dy dz$

$\oint_Cx^3 dx+4y^2 dy$

∑ i = 1 n a i \sum_{i=1}^na_i i=1nai

∑ i = 1 n a i \sum\limits_{i=1}^na_i i=1nai

∏ i = 1 n a i \prod_{i=1}^na_i i=1nai

∏ i = 1 n a i \prod\limits_{i=1}^na_i i=1nai

lim ⁡ n → ∞ x n \lim_{n\to\infty}x_n limnxn

lim ⁡ n → ∞ x n \lim\limits_{n\to\infty}x_n nlimxn

∫ − N N e x d x \int_{-N}^{N}e^x dx NNexdx

∬ M N d x d y \iint_M^Ndx dy MNdxdy

∭ M N d x d y d z \iiint_M^Ndx dy dz MNdxdydz

∮ C x 3 d x + 4 y 2 d y \oint_Cx^3 dx+4y^2 dy Cx3dx+4y2dy


  1. 脚注内容 ↩︎

  • 17
    点赞
  • 18
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值